London (All Stations) to Bathgate by train

Planning a train journey from London (All Stations) to Bathgate? The trip usually takes about 5hrs 35 mins, covering approximately 336 miles (540 kilometres). With roughly 20 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£35.50,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from London (All Stations) to Bathgate start from as little as £35.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from London (All Stations) to Bathgate start from £93.20 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from London (All Stations) to Bathgate are available for £201.50 one way

Rich Amenities and Passenger Services

Step into Bathgate Train Station and immerse yourself in a variety of amenities designed for convenience. The ticket office operates from 07:00 to 13:40 on weekdays and Saturdays, while Sundays offer a slightly extended service until 14:00. Visitors can utilize ticket machines for online purchase collections, making the entire process seamless and straightforward. Accessibility is a strong focus at Bathgate, with step-free access across the station, induction loops, and accessible ticket machines ensuring all passengers travel smoothly. The station also boasts a hefty 570 parking spaces with 20 designated for Blue Badge holders.
